| Ant's current CVS version contains an <input> task that gathers user | |||
| input by reading from System.in - this is not too nice for people | |||
| embedding Ant in IDEs. 8-) | |||
| <input> also supports an undocumented testinput attribute that is used | |||
| by Ant's test cases to allow them to run without user interaction, but | |||
| could also be used to provide predefined answers to unattended builds. | |||
| This proposal tries to define a very basic input framework for Ant | |||
| that would allow Ant to be easily embedded into IDEs via | |||
| implementations of the org.apache.tools.ant.input.InputHandler | |||
| interface. At the same time an implementation of the interface is | |||
| provided that allows the input to be specified via an external | |||
| property file. | |||
| There are three implementations of the InputHandler interface, | |||
| DefaultInputHandler which reads form System.in just like the <input> | |||
| task originally did, PropertyFileInputHandler for non-interactive | |||
| builds and SwingInputHandler which is nothing more than a proof of | |||
| concept. | |||
| Input requests get encapsulated in instances of the | |||
| org.apache.tools.ant.input.InputRequest class - or subclasses thereof | |||
| - which provide a method to also validate the input, moving this | |||
| responsibility from the <input> task to the InputRequest itself. | |||
| There are two types of InputRequests ATM, InputRequest encapsulates a | |||
| request for a simple unrestricted text input, | |||
| MultipleChoiceInputRequest is a request where valid inputs are | |||
| restricted to a given set of values. | |||
| If you run ant on the build file in this directory, a version of | |||
| ant.jar will be created in the build subdirectory that is identical to | |||
| the main trunk of Ant except for the input task itself and two minor | |||
| changes to Project and Main, that allow InputHandlers to be plugged in | |||
| programmatically or via a commandline switch -inputhandler. | |||
| With this version of Ant, run the build file in proposals/testcases, | |||
| Ant should behave the same way the input task for the main branch does | |||
| - except that it won't allow you to enter invalid input in the multi | |||
| target. | |||
| If you invoke Ant like this: | |||
| ant -f proposal/sandbox/input/src/testcases/input.xml -inputhandler org.apache.tools.ant.input.SwingInputHandler | |||
| You'll get the ugliest dialog you've ever seen, but it works ;-) | |||
| Finally, use | |||
| ANT_OPTS=-Dinput.properties=proposal/sandbox/input/src/testcases/works.properties | |||
| ant -f proposal/sandbox/input/src/testcases/input.xml -inputhandler org.apache.tools.ant.input.PropertyFileInputHandler | |||
| to see the non-interactive build process in action. fails.properties | |||
| provides a sample of possible input failures. | |||

| package org.apache.tools.ant.input; | |||
| /** | |||
| * Plugin to Ant to handle requests for user input. | |||
| * | |||
| * @author <a href="mailto:stefan.bodewig@epost.de">Stefan Bodewig</a> | |||
| * @version $Revision$ | |||
| */ | |||
| public interface InputHandler { | |||
| void handleInput(InputRequest request) | |||
| throws org.apache.tools.ant.BuildException; | |||
| } | |||

| package org.apache.tools.ant.input; | |||
| import org.apache.tools.ant.BuildException; | |||
| import java.io.FileInputStream; | |||
| import java.io.IOException; | |||
| import java.util.Properties; | |||
| /** | |||
| * Reads input from a property file, the file name is read from the | |||
| * system property input.properties, the prompt is the key for input. | |||
| * | |||
| * @author <a href="mailto:stefan.bodewig@epost.de">Stefan Bodewig</a> | |||
| * @version $Revision$ | |||
| */ | |||
| public class PropertyFileInputHandler implements InputHandler { | |||
| private Properties props = null; | |||
| /** | |||
| * Empty no-arg constructor. | |||
| */ | |||
| public PropertyFileInputHandler() { | |||
| } | |||
| public synchronized void handleInput(InputRequest request) | |||
| throws BuildException { | |||
| if (props == null) { | |||
| readProps(); | |||
| } | |||
| Object o = props.get(request.getPrompt()); | |||
| if (o == null) { | |||
| throw new BuildException("Unable to find input for " | |||
| + request.getPrompt()); | |||
| } | |||
| request.setInput(o.toString()); | |||
| if (!request.isInputValid()) { | |||
| throw new BuildException("Found invalid input " + o | |||
| + " for " + request.getPrompt()); | |||
| } | |||
| } | |||
| private void readProps() throws BuildException { | |||
| String propsFile = System.getProperty("input.properties"); | |||
| if (propsFile == null) { | |||
| throw new BuildException("System property input.properties for PropertyFileInputHandler not set"); | |||
| } | |||
| props = new Properties(); | |||
| try { | |||
| props.load(new FileInputStream(propsFile)); | |||
| } catch (IOException e) { | |||
| throw new BuildException("Couldn't load "+propsFile, e); | |||
| } | |||
| } | |||
| } | |||

| package org.apache.tools.ant.taskdefs; | |||
| import java.util.StringTokenizer; | |||
| import java.util.Vector; | |||
| import org.apache.tools.ant.BuildException; | |||
| import org.apache.tools.ant.Project; | |||
| import org.apache.tools.ant.Task; | |||
| import org.apache.tools.ant.input.InputRequest; | |||
| import org.apache.tools.ant.input.MultipleChoiceInputRequest; | |||
| /** | |||
| * Ant task to read input line from console. | |||
| * | |||
| * @author <a href="mailto:usch@usch.net">Ulrich Schmidt</a> | |||
| */ | |||
| public class Input extends Task { | |||
| private String validargs = null; | |||
| private String message = ""; | |||
| private String addproperty = null; | |||
| /** | |||
| * Defines valid input parameters as comma separated String. If set, input | |||
| * task will reject any input not defined as accepted and requires the user | |||
| * to reenter it. Validargs are case sensitive. If you want 'a' and 'A' to | |||
| * be accepted you need to define both values as accepted arguments. | |||
| * | |||
| * @param validargs A comma separated String defining valid input args. | |||
| */ | |||
| public void setValidargs (String validargs) { | |||
| this.validargs = validargs; | |||
| } | |||
| /** | |||
| * Defines the name of a property to be created from input. Behaviour is | |||
| * according to property task which means that existing properties | |||
| * cannot be overriden. | |||
| * | |||
| * @param addproperty Name for the property to be created from input | |||
| */ | |||
| public void setAddproperty (String addproperty) { | |||
| this.addproperty = addproperty; | |||
| } | |||
| /** | |||
| * Sets the Message which gets displayed to the user during the build run. | |||
| * @param message The message to be displayed. | |||
| */ | |||
| public void setMessage (String message) { | |||
| this.message = message; | |||
| } | |||
| /** | |||
| * Set a multiline message. | |||
| */ | |||
| public void addText(String msg) { | |||
| message += getProject().replaceProperties(msg); | |||
| } | |||
| /** | |||
| * No arg constructor. | |||
| */ | |||
| public Input () { | |||
| } | |||
| /** | |||
| * Actual test method executed by jakarta-ant. | |||
| * @exception BuildException | |||
| */ | |||
| public void execute () throws BuildException { | |||
| InputRequest request = null; | |||
| if (validargs != null) { | |||
| Vector accept = new Vector(); | |||
| StringTokenizer stok = new StringTokenizer(validargs, ",", false); | |||
| while (stok.hasMoreTokens()) { | |||
| accept.addElement(stok.nextToken()); | |||
| } | |||
| request = new MultipleChoiceInputRequest(message, accept); | |||
| } else { | |||
| request = new InputRequest(message); | |||
| } | |||
| getProject().getInputHandler().handleInput(request); | |||
| if (addproperty != null) { | |||
| if (project.getProperty(addproperty) == null) { | |||
| project.setProperty(addproperty, request.getInput()); | |||
| } else { | |||
| log("Override ignored for " + addproperty, | |||
| Project.MSG_VERBOSE); | |||
| } | |||
| } | |||
| } | |||
| } | |||
